Questions About WWII

U.S. History 1877 to Present - World War II

QuestionAnswer
How did post-World War I Europe set the stage for World War II? Political and economic conditions in Europe following World War I led to the rise of fascism and to World War II
How did the rise of fascism affect world events following World War I? The rise of fascism threatened peace in Europe and Asia.
What were the causes of World War II? Political instability and economic devastation in Europe resulting from World War I; worldwide depression; high war debt owed by Germany; high inflation; massive unemployment
The United States entered WWII after being attacked by who and where? Japan attacked the United States at Pearl Harbor
What is anti-semitism? Aryan supremacy; systematic attempt to rid Europe of all Jews
What were tactics used to get rid of Jews during the Holocaust? Boycott of Jewish stores; threats; segregation; imprisonment and killing of Jews and others in concentration camps;lberation by Allied forces of Jews and others in concentration camp
How did Americans at home support the war effort? American involvement in the war bought an end to the Great Depression. Thousands of women took jobs in defense plants. Americans consevered and rationed resources.
How did the United States help rebuild postwar Europe? The United States instituted George C. Marshall’s plan to rebuild Europe (the Marshall Plan), which provided massive financial aid to rebuild European economies and prevent the spread of communism. Germany was partitioned into East and West Germany.
What contributed to the prosperity of Americans following World War II? With rationing of consumer goods over, business converted from production of war materials to consumer goods; Americans purchased goods on credit; the workforce shifted back to men, and most women returned to family responsibilities.
